The present invention relates to a yawing speed bump installed in a road surface to minimize the pitching phenomenon generated in a vehicle passing through a speed bump. According to the present invention, action of a wave corresponding to yawing navigation is applied to a speed bump in the ground. A bump is formed to prevent overspeed of a vehicle as the bump is installed in a road to have a fixed height and width and an upper surface is formed as a curved part. Moreover, the bump is installed to set at least one yawing angle wherein pitching and rolling are mixed in the moving direction of a vehicle. According to the present invention, when a vehicle passes through a speed bump, a buffering effect fused with properties of a suspension apparatus is obtained due to action of strolling and passing with all fours. Therefore, the present invention has effects of preventing discomfort from being caused, improving safety of a passenger, extending the service life of a vehicle by minimizing a pitching shock. |
